Is there a reason why `gnus-default-subscribed-newsgroups' is a list and not a regular expression, which IMO would be more convenient in most cases? Example: if the variable is set in a site-wide default setting the administor has to keep up with frequently changes of the available local newsgroups. Quite annoying, I think. As a regular expression, the setting "local\." would suffice (until the end of the world as we know it).
